Warehouse Supervisor  - Your future position?

 

As the Warehouse Supervisor, you will collect and consolidate production schedules and inventory data to plan weekly and daily material flows and inform needs in terms of material/product stocks to satisfy demand and supply without creating business disruptions. You will be reporting to Logistics Manager while based in Ayer Keroh, Melaka. 

 

Sounds interesting? In this exciting role you also will:

  • Review production schedules, customer orders, shipping orders, and requisitions to determine items for movement, gathering, and distribution. Prioritize work orders and dispatch them to the team.

  • Oversee the reception of incoming materials, including related administrative tasks such as batch number recordings, goods receipt issuance, and materials labeling. Also, supervise dispatching and storage activities.

  • Ensure the preparation of materials/products for shipment aligns with customer orders in terms of quantity and type.

  • Monitor the loading, unloading, moving, stacking, and staging of products and materials in designated areas, following predetermined sequences based on factors such as size, type, style, color, or product code.

  • Operate computers, including desktop PCs and handheld devices, for tasks such as receiving, real-time inventory updates, and processing customer order shipments to achieve daily KPIs.

  • Ensure warehouse operations comply with company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) guidelines and public safety regulations, particularly when using forklifts, clamp trucks, or handling hazardous materials/products.

  • Supervise the maintenance of warehouse facilities and equipment, ensuring they are kept clean, safe, and operational. Report service requests as needed.

  • Identify capability gaps within the team and conduct training sessions to address them effectively.

  • Lead stock count or cycle count exercises as required to maintain accurate inventory records.

  • Maintain overall cleanliness of the warehouse, including office spaces, storage areas, racks, loading bays, compounds, waste areas, and operational equipment, including charging areas.

Your professional profile includes:

  • Diploma in Logistics or a relevant field.

  • 5 to 6 years of experience in warehouse department within a manufacturing environment.

  • Leadership or supervisor experience is highly ideal.

  • Good understanding of factory warehouse process flow from end to end & familiarity with production process flow and scheduling.

  • Skills in operating Material Handling Equipment (MHE) such as forklifts, reach trucks, and hand pallet trucks.

  • Proficient in transportation guidelines, material/product safety regulations, and inventory management processes/tools.

  • Strong traits of independence, maturity, and decision-making skills.

  • Competence in computer skills, including M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, etc.) or advantageous to have knowledge of SAP.

  • Ability to work on a shift basis.

  • Able to work in Ayer Keroh, Melaka.
